//跳转参数控制器
var jumpParamsContorls = {
types: [{
name: '京东可转链网页(网页跳转方式)',
template: "{\"url\":\"http://apph5.banliapp.com/help/jd.html?url={内容}\"}"
},
{
name: '百川网页',
template: "{\"url\":\"http://apph5.banliapp.com/help/tb.html?url={内容}\"}"
},
{
name: '团油',
template: "{\"url\":\"http://apph5.banliapp.com/help/tuanyou.html\"}"
},
{
name: '通用链接(网页/百川跳转方式)',
template: "{\"url\":\"{内容}\"}"
}
],
init: function(navContainer) {
//加入弹出层
var html = "";
html += "
";
html += "
";
html += "
";
$("body").append(html);
},
show: function(callback) {
var dialog = layer.open({
type: 1,
title: '跳转参数选择',
shadeClose: true,
shade: 0.8,
area: ['650px', '300px'],
content: $("#jumpParamsDialog").html(), //iframe的url
});
layui.use('form', function() {
form = layui.form;
});
//监听提交
form.on('submit(sure)', function(data) {
var index = parseInt($(".layui-layer-content").find("#jumpParamsType").eq(0).val());
var type = jumpParamsContorls.types[index];
var content = $(".layui-layer-content").find("#jumpParamsContent").eq(0).val();
callback(type.template.replace("{内容}", content));
layer.close(dialog);
return false;
});
setTimeout(function() {
form.render();
}, 100);
setTimeout(function() {
$("#control .cancel").bind("click", function() {
layer.close(dialog);
});
}, 100);
}
};